   RCSCC GRENVILLE   

RCSCC GRENVILLE



Click arms to view larger image
 
 
 
Blazon: Sable, upon a chapeau Gules turned up ermine, a griffin passant Or.
Significance: The badge is that of HMS GRENVILLE. The griffin passant on a "chapeau" or "cap of maintenance" is the crest of the Grenville family, long famous in the Royal Navy.
Notes: RCSCC Grenville, Kelowna, British Columbia
Artist: LCdr Steve Cowan, Area Cadet Instructor Cadre Officer (Sea), Vancouver Island.
